Selecting Safe Peanuts for Garden Birds

When it comes to attracting garden birds, offering them a variety of foods is essential for creating a thriving wildlife haven. One popular choice among bird enthusiasts is peanuts, known for their high nutritional value and ability to draw in a diverse range of species. However, not all peanut varieties are created equal when it comes to feeding the wild. Selecting safe peanuts for your feathered friends requires careful consideration, especially when sourcing from the UK.
For garden birds, split peanuts for birds UK or those sold in bulk as 'bird corn' can be a fantastic option. These peanuts are typically pre-split, making them easier for smaller birds to crack open and consume. Moreover, they provide a concentrated source of energy and protein, vital for sustaining birds during colder months when food is scarce. When buying peanuts UK naturally sourced, opt for those that are specifically labeled as 'raw' or 'unroasted'. Roasted peanuts often contain added salts and spices that can be harmful to birds.
The best peanuts for wild birds are those that are unsalted and unprocessed. Many reputable suppliers in the UK offer split peanuts designed specifically for bird feeding, ensuring they meet these criteria. Birds such as blue tits, great tits, and nuthatches are particularly partial to peanuts, and their energy-rich properties make them an excellent winter food source. When setting up your feeding station, consider using a variety of feeding methods to cater to different bird habits. For example, a hanging feeder is ideal for smaller birds like finches, while a platform feeder suits larger species such as jays and woodpigeons. Additionally, offering a mix of peanut varieties, including raw and roasted, can provide a more diverse diet and enhance the overall experience for your garden visitors.
To maximise bird attraction, ensure your feeding station is well-placed in a quiet, sheltered area of your garden. Birds tend to feel safer in peaceful locations away from potential predators, so maintaining a calm environment will encourage them to visit regularly. Moreover, providing a clean and consistent supply of fresh peanuts, such as those bought in bulk from reputable UK suppliers, will keep your feathered friends coming back for more. Regularly cleaning and refilling feeders is essential, as it maintains the health and hygiene of your garden visitors and ensures they continue to view your station as a reliable food source.
